Summary of the contracting process

Housing 21 commissioned works to replace or install flat entrance doors at Duke Bernard Court. The requirement is classified as installation of door frames, so it is relevant to contractors undertaking door, frame and associated flat entrance works rather than to general suppliers of building materials. Housing 21 is the buying organisation. The awarded works relate to one site and one requirement, with delivery associated with Duke Bernard Court. The procurement is categorised as works and concerns a residential housing setting. The selected supplier is B&G Estate Limited, a small or medium-sized enterprise. The scope indicates a specialist property-maintenance or building contractor able to carry out flat entrance door work in occupied or managed housing environments.

This procurement has been awarded following a below-threshold limited competition. The tender reached complete status, with one completed lot. Housing 21 signed the contract with B&G Estate Limited on 7 August 2026. The awarded contract value is £120,941 excluding VAT, or £145,129.20 including VAT. The contract period runs from 1 November 2026 to 31 January 2027. The contract is active. The opportunity was evaluated through the limited-competition route, and the published outcome identifies installation of door frames as the awarded work. The award relates to the single lot and was made to B&G Estate Limited. This is a completed procurement outcome rather than an invitation to submit a bid.
